Tactically, Optisphere differentiates from our competitors through our application of advanced technologies to create innovative total network solutions that enable carriers to maximize network investment and can be deployed quickly to generate new revenue.In support of our customers' need to effectively manage capital expenses, Optisphere has developed a revolutionary optical networking solution that closely aligns with carriers' network and traffic behavior, and simplifies operations and network management. This solution addresses the highest cost elements in the network, specifically transponders and regenerators. As part of our "Transparent Network Solution", we have built products that offer a combination of a superior span performance system and fully flexible Optical Add Drop Multiplexers (OADMs) in the nodes of the core network that will enable us to take advantage of the large amount of pass-through traffic (i.e. express traffic) in the core. This allows us to configure optical networks with fewer regenerators and avoid deploying complex and costly switch matrices. This solution meets carriers' network requirements to simplify the operations and provisioning of network elements, reduce risks associated with deploying large switch matrices, and significantly reduce the costs associated with O/E/O as well as line costs. It is this seamless combination of grooming devices at the edge of the core/backbone network and an integrated OADM and high performance DWDM transport system that forms the networking platform of Optisphere's Transparent Network SolutionOptisphere's optical products are integrated into one common network platform that can be applied to Long Haul, Ultra Long Haul, Bandwidth Optimization and Network Management applications. Plus, our technology is designed around a small footprint that uses significantly less power and floor space than existing equipment.Key elements of our end-to-end portfolio include:Multi-Haul DWDM Solution: Optisphere's unique Multi-Haul DWDM transmission solution enables carriers to transport 2.5, 10 Gbps and 40 Gbps optical bit-rates on the same fiber on a route-specific basis, thus reducing the need for multiple, single-application DWDM systems. This is accomplished using sophisticated transponders and multiplexing transponders that support multiple vendor and service types. This approach results in tremendous cost savings and investment protection, enabling carriers to reduce the number of vendors in the network and realize significant savings in capital spending, operations, training, sparing, provisioning and floor space. Our Multiwavelength Transport System (MTS) is the ultimate transport solution. A modular, DWDM ultra-high capacity Long Haul and Ultra Long Haul transport system, MTS can handle all types of long-distance traffic on a single platform -- up to 160 wavelengths at 10 Gbps. Our MTS C Band application delivers longer span performance with fewer regenerators and can grow to 160 channels. An 80-wavelength 40 Gbps system, scheduled for 2002 will allow carriers to cost-effectively address their long-term, optical transport needs. The MTS Multi-Haul platform is highly scalable to allow for incremental network and investment growth. This offers carriers even more value from an already modular and flexible platform and provides them with a way to extract more performance from their existing network.Ultra Long Haul Capabilities: Our Multi-Haul DWDM solution also provides true Ultra Long Haul capabilities. The MTS platform supports extremely long span performance, which reduces the number of regenerators required in the network. It also supports more spans before needing a regen site. Moreover, the MTS Multi-Haul platform can be easily upgraded to support even longer spans. It is a single platform that gives carriers' the capability to maximize their DWDM network investment while cost effectively managing Ultra Long Haul growth.TransPlan Network Planning Tool: A PC-based route-planning tool designed specifically for the MTS. TransPlan features a GUI that simplifies network planning, design, engineering, and cost analysis. TransPlan enables the quick and accurate modeling of the placement of network components, speeding route design while reducing manpower expenses.Optical Channel Unit (OCU): The OCU houses multiple types of transponders, multiplexers and regenerators integral to the MTS. These components can operate in a plug and play mode due to the OCU's unique design where no traffic appears on the backplane. This allows for any card with any bandwidth to reside in any slot. The OCU provides 2.5 Gbps, 10 Gbps and 40 Gbps multiplexing capabilities with 3R regeneration and protection switching all on a single shelf. It also supports a variety of Optical Channel Protection strategies including 1:n protection.Managed Optical Distribution Frame (MODIF): A unique approach that combines the integration of a Graphical User Interface (GUI) software with the optical patch panel to automate the implementation and management of optical patch panels and provisioning of circuits. Flow-through provisioning via TNMS ensures that accurate records of all connections are maintained and updated as required.As part of the Transparent Optical Networking strategy, MODIF supports wavelength provisioning and intelligent connection management. This intelligent SW-controlled patch panel is used at all nodes, allowing remote visibility and management of all network-connections. It also supports fast and intelligent delivery of lambda services. MODIF keeps track of used / available / remaining capacity and can trigger user-selectable threshold-based "add-capacity" message.Bandwidth Optimization: Optisphere is addressing the need for optimizing existing network capacity with unique solutions. Optisphere's TEX solution enables carriers to extract more value from their existing DWDM networks by gaining more bandwidth over the same network. TEX – which stands for Ten-Gigabit Multiplexer – enables carriers to multiplex four 2.5 Gbps signals into a 10 Gbps signal and hand off the signal into existing equipment. Carriers can maximize DWDM channels and expand network capacity at a very low cost. Our FOX solution is a 40 Gbps multiplexing transponder that enables carriers to multiplex four 10 Gbps signals onto a 40 Gbps signal using a single card. FOX expands network capacity to 40 Gbps without costly upgrades. Both TEX and FOX can interoperate with existing network infrastructure and provide cost effective alternatives to infrastructure expansions.Network Management: TNMS, our comprehensive sixth generation network management solution provides complete operations support for all Optisphere products. TNMS combines network and element management, and enables the comprehensive display, configuration, and monitoring of the entire transport network. Using CORBA-based interfaces, the TNMS system integrates seamlessly with other manufacturers' systems.Superior product design adds up to an excellent return on investment throughout the life cycle of Optisphere's products.
